日志Linux下查看Tomcat日志的方法(linux查看tomcat)

Tomcat是一款开源的应用服务器,可以处理常见的Java组件和JavaServer Pages(JSP)组件。Tomcat可在Linux环境下部署,在保证Tomcat的正常运行的情况下,常常需要查看访问日志,以便进行业务分布监控、改进程序性能,以及更多的高级维护操作。本文将介绍Linux系统下查看Tomcat日志的一些方法。

一、查看Tomcat日志文件

Tomcat日志的默认路径为$CATALINA_HOME/logs下,Tomcat程序的安装路径也可能不同,可以在Tomcat启动时在控制台指定-Dcatalina.home参数,设置Tomcat日志路径。

命令:

CATALINA_HOME = /usr/local/tomcat
tail -200f $CATALINA_HOME/logs/catalina.out

tail –200f $CATALINA_HOME/logs/catalina.out 将在当前terminal控制台输出Tomcat日志前200行信息,如果想查看全部日志,可以去掉 -200f参数 。

二、Tomcat日志记录等级

可以根据业务情况,调整Tomcat日志的记录等级:

(1)FATAL:严重错误,运行终止

(2)ERROR:错误,但是可以继续运行

(3)WARN:警告,但可以继续运行

(4)INFO:基本信息,一般用于跟踪程序运行状态

(5)DEBUG:调试级别,记录复杂信息,用于调试程序

可以在conf/logging.properties文件中,修改相应的等级

三、cron定时脚本

可以使用cron定时脚本记录Tomcat的日志,按照指定的时间间隔把日志文件记录到本地磁盘,确保Tomcat日志在未来可以使用,以下是一个cron定时脚本的例子:

*/5 * * * * cd $CATALINA_HOME/logs && cat catalina.out > catalina.out_$(date +"%Y-%m-%d_%H-%M-%S")

经过以上步骤,Linux系统用户就可以通过Tomcat日志查看Tomcat程序的运行情况,进而做出合理的管理操作,让Tomcat系统更加稳定和高效。


数据运维技术 » 日志Linux下查看Tomcat日志的方法(linux查看tomcat)